Security Automation information

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ive in the security automation position, and why are they important?

To thrive in Security Automation, you need solid experience in cybersecurity principles, scripting languages (such as Python or PowerShell), and automation frameworks, often supported by a degree in computer science or an industry certification like CISSP or SSCP. Familiarity with security information and event management (SIEM) tools, orchestration platforms, and automated testing suites is commonly required. Attention to detail, strong analytical thinking, and effective communication skills help professionals solve complex security challenges and collaborate across IT and security teams. These skills are crucial for identifying, responding to, and automating mitigation of cyber threats efficiently and reliably.

What are the typical daily responsibilities of someone working in security automation?

Professionals in Security Automation typically spend their days developing, testing, and maintaining scripts or workflows that automate security-related tasks, such as monitoring for vulnerabilities, responding to incidents, and managing access controls. They work closely with cybersecurity analysts, IT teams, and sometimes developers to identify repetitive manual tasks that can be streamlined through automation. A portion of the role often involves researching emerging threats and updating automated tools to better detect and respond to them. This position offers a dynamic work environment where you'll frequently tackle problem-solving and process improvement, all while helping to strengthen the organization’s overall security posture.

What is a security automation?

A Security Automation job involves designing, implementing, and maintaining automated security processes to enhance an organization's cybersecurity posture. Professionals in this role use scripts, tools, and frameworks to detect, respond to, and mitigate security threats efficiently. They work with security teams to create automated workflows for threat analysis, incident response, and compliance enforcement. This role requires knowledge of cybersecurity principles, programming, and automation tools like SIEM, SOAR, and scripting languages.
